**Action item: autocomplete index latency (Queryline search).**

Root cause: the suffix index rebuilt synchronously on every dictionary update, blocking reads for up to 40s. Fix: move rebuilds to a shadow index with atomic swap. Security note for review: rebuild worker now reads the term dictionary with a scoped, read-only role; no broader grants were added. Rate limits on the suggest endpoint were retightened as part of this work. Final tuning constants below.

tuning table, fawip-fahag:
WEIGHTS = {
    "novwyn": 452,
    "casdor": 675,
}

## v3.2.1 — Pagination & Key Rotation

Cursor pagination is now default on all public Wrenfall API list endpoints; offset params are deprecated until Q3. Page size caps at 200.

We also rotated the response-signing key as scheduled. Update your verifier before deploying. The new signing key follows.

deploy key for tafof-hahop: bky4_o1oo

Internal Memo — Budget Request: Tollam Line Upgrade

To the incoming director: we are requesting capital approval to upgrade the Tollam packaging line. Current equipment is past end-of-life; downtime cost us an estimated 140 production hours last quarter. The request covers two new fillers, conveyor retrofit, and operator training. Payback modeled at 19 months. Finance has reviewed the figures; procurement has quotes from two vendors. Approval needed before the Q4 planning lock. Context on the related strategic direction follows below.

internal memo for yahag-tahog: The pricing group signed off on a budget of $152.8 million for Project Soriel.